Owing to the human engineering activities, the phenomenon that new landslide happen on the upper part of the old sliding body can be found everywhere. This kind of slope consisting of two sliding bodies, which are upper body and lower body, is named as double-sliding-body slope. Its stability is usually analyzed according to two slopes. However, the effect of new landslide movement on the stability of entire slope system is not taken into account. In this paper, sliding effect of upper body is analyzed, and the formula considering sliding effect of upper body is derived based on Sarma method for analysis of entire slope. Theoretical analysis and a case history indicate that the spasmodic motion of upper body has bad effect on the lower body stability; Sliding along the top face of lower body, the effect on the lower body is disadvantageous during starting instant. Nevertheless, the bad effect will disappear and transform as the advantageous effect as descending of the slope gradient and sliding acceleration. For the slope controlling, the sliding effect of upper body should be considered in the stability analysis of double-sliding-body slope, thus it will help us recognizing and mastering or forecasting the evaluative trend of double-siding-body slope. Further reliable scientific basis can be provided in order to make effective controlling measures. |
